Меню Рубрики

Windows 10 storage spaces refs

Как отключить или включить ReFS или Resilient File System в Windows 10

С тех пор как NTFS была разработана и сформулирована в ОС Windows, требования к хранилищу данных резко изменились. Существовала острая необходимость в файловой системе следующего поколения, которая могла бы хорошо работать и решать проблемы, которые присутствовали в NTFS. Именно тогда Microsoft в 2012 году назвала снимки и разработала ReFS (Resilient File System) — и была представлена ​​в Windows 8.1 и Windows Server 2012 . ReFS была разработана для максимизации доступности и надежности данных , даже если соответствующие устройства хранения данных испытали аппаратный сбой.

С тех пор, как запоминающие устройства вошли в игру, потребность в дисковом пространстве увеличилась в геометрической прогрессии. В наши дни распространены даже мульти-терабайты накопителей. Следовательно, потребность в постоянно надежной структуре продолжала возникать одновременно. ReFS имеет архитектуру, которая хорошо работает с чрезвычайно большими наборами данных без какого-либо влияния на производительность. В этом руководстве мы увидим, как включить или отключить файловую систему ReFS в Windows 10 и попытаться отформатировать диск, используя его, но перед этим давайте рассмотрим некоторые ключевые функции этой величественной файловой системы.

В этой статье мы поговорим о функциях отказоустойчивой файловой системы и узнаем, как включить или отключить файловую систему ReFS в операционной системе Windows Server, а также попробуем отформатировать диск, использующий эту файловую систему.

Особенности отказоустойчивой файловой системы

Доступность данных . Файловая система ReFS расширяет доступность данных, демонстрируя устойчивость к повреждению или сбоям данных. Автоматические проверки целостности данных помогают поддерживать ReFS в сети, и вы вряд ли будете испытывать какое-либо время простоя.

Масштабируемость при растяжении: Требования к увеличению объема и размера данных постоянно растут в связи с изменяющейся технологией. ReFS предлагает возможность бросать вызов чрезвычайно большим наборам данных и работать с ними без проблем с производительностью.

Острое исправление ошибок: файловая система ReFS поставляется с автоматическим сканером целостности данных, известным как скруббер , который периодически сканирует том данных, выявляет потенциальные поврежденные сектора и обрабатывает их для восстановления. ,

ОБНОВЛЕНИЕ . Пожалуйста, прочитайте комментарии ниже, прежде чем продолжить. Дэн Гюль говорит: Опубликовать годовое обновление , это в основном сделает систему непригодной для использования, и по-прежнему невозможно будет выполнять форматирование в ReFS.

Какую файловую систему использует Windows 10?

Если это стандартная установка по умолчанию, ОС использует структуры NTFS. При сбое операционной системы Windows 10 с включенным дисковым пространством это файловые системы ReFS + NTFS.

Включить файловую систему ReFS в Windows 10

Теперь, когда вы знаете, что ReFS появился, чтобы справиться с ограничениями файловой системы NTFS, давайте посмотрим, как вы можете включить его в своей системе Windows 10 и использовать его для форматирования внешнего диска.

Прежде чем приступить к изменениям, обязательно создайте точку восстановления системы. Если в будущем возникнет какая-либо проблема, вы можете использовать эту точку восстановления для отката изменений.

1. Нажмите Windows Key + R на клавиатуре, чтобы запустить приглашение «Выполнить». Введите regedit.exe и нажмите Enter, чтобы открыть редактор реестра.

2. Перейдите по указанному ниже пути на левой боковой панели редактора реестра.

H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 FileSystem

3. Создайте DWORD и назовите его RefsDisableLastAccessUpdate. Установите его значение как 1 , чтобы включить его.

4. Далее, перейдите к указанному ниже пути на левой боковой панели.

H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 MinInt

5. Если ключ MiniNT не существует, его можно создать, щелкнув правой кнопкой мыши> Создать> Ключ.

Теперь под этим ключом создайте новый DWORD и назовите его AllowRefsFormatOverNonmirrorVolume и установите его значение как 1 , чтобы включить его.

6. Выйдите и войдите снова, чтобы изменения вступили в силу. Теперь вы можете подключить внешнее устройство и выбрать файловую систему ReFS для его форматирования. Кроме того, вы можете открыть лист Свойства любого диска, чтобы увидеть, с какой файловой системой он связан.

Вы можете прочитать больше о ReFS или Resilient File System на Technet.

Источник

Windows 10 storage spaces refs

The following forum(s) have migrated to Microsoft Q&A: All English Windows 10 IT Pro forums!
Visit Microsoft Q&A to post new questions.

Asked by:

Question

Is there anywhere at all that lists what features Storage Spaces in Win10 1903 supports?

Have been playing with setting up a NAS & Plex server using Storage Spaces, currently have 3x 10TB Seagate Constellation HDD’s setup in a pool. Ideally I want to have it using Parity & REFS with Integrity enabled.

Initial testing of this has shown performance is pretty terrible (I wasn’t expecting a lot from parity, but was expecting more than 20-30MB/s)…

A while back when planning the build, I was looking into options around using storage tiers as in Windows server, but could never find any good info. and still can’t really find anything concrete, although did find this — https://steemit.com/windows/@fobio/windows-10-storage-spaces-and-write-back-cache-and-how-to

While not tiering, the person seems to think Win10 will use 2 SSD’s in a storage pool as a mirrored writeback cache. Is there anywhere that can confirm this? Realistically this would probably be fine for my needs. But.

What about tiering? Would be amazing to have a mirrored SDD tier for hot data infront of a parity HDD tier for cold data. S2D in Windows Server clusters kinda has this, although I did see something that indicated once data was tiered out of the SSD, it wouldn’t be promoted back up ever. Seems more like just a large mirrored write cache.

Any and all help would be appreciated!

All replies

you can use Storage Spaces tiering in Win 10.

If you have a hardware RAID, i’d create RAID1 for SSD and RAID5 for HDD and build autotiered volume on top of it.

From Microsoft official doc we can see that ReFS is applied to Server system(Windows Server 2019, Windows Server 2016, Windows Server 2012 R2, Windows Server 2012) rather than client system…

So your idea may bring some unexpected result on Windows 10, please take care of it.

Unlike its NTFS counterpart, ReFS consumes more system resources and has more impact on IOP of a disk. In a server environment this is not factor, but on a normal PC, this can have impact on usage. The bigger the ReFS disk array is, the more RAM, processor cycles and disk IOPs it will use for checking File Integrity

On Windows 10, you could configure Tiered Storage Spaces. The case below give you detailed information

Storage spaces on Windows 10 and tiering

Please Note: Since the website is not hosted by Microsoft, the link may change without notice. Microsoft does not guarantee the accuracy of this information.

Please remember to mark the replies as answers if they help.
If you have feedback for TechNet Subscriber Support, contact tnmff@microsoft.com.

I’m the guy you quoted on your OP.

I found this thread looking for differences between Win10 Storage Spaces vs Storage Spaces Direct in 2019. as the version of SS in Win10 works a bit differently than SSD in WS2019, especially since the Win10 SS version seems to be updated more frequently. I can tell you, even within a single node, I see quite a bit of difference between Win10 SS and WS2019 SSD. Since the thread you’ve linked, I’ve played with mirror-accelerated parity using 6x 240GB SSD in mirror and 5x 8TB SMR drives in single parity. and in REFS.

I have no definitive data, but the setup you quoted from Steemit was much simpler with the SSD drives simply denoted as «Journal» drives. In WS2019, using REFS and mirror-accelerated parity, I was not able to duplicate such speeds [30mb/s +] using the SMR drives. Since Storage Spaces Direct is the only form of SS you can run on WS2019, I believe its implementation and hardware requirements to be also different than Win10. This is especially apparent when using consumer grade SSD’s as cache.

For my simple usage of storing media and very little random writes, in a single node, I am considering using the simpler but more efficient Win10 Storage Spaces, even in NTFS, over WS2019 Storage Spaces Direct that has more stringent deployment and hardware requirements.

Hey VC.1, Nice to see you here 🙂

I ended up giving it a shot & appear to have got the Mirrored Accelerated Parity working with Win10 1903.
I’ve got 2x SSD infront of 3x HDD. The Win10 SS GUI just shows it as mirrored, but via powershell can see the 2 tiers being Mirrored & Parity.

Interestingly, after creating it all, it appears the storage space was created using the Server 2019 version of storage spaces. When opening the Win10 GUI it prompted to update the storage space version, after which the powershell info shows the SS version as ‘v.next’ now. (confirming what you said with client SS versions getting updated before server SS versions)

I’ve set Write-Back cache probably far too big though rather than the default. So considering rebuilding again if i can find something big enough to dump my data off to now. Do you know of any downsides to having the write-back cache set too large?

Happy to send you the commands i’ve used to create my pool/vdisks if you like.

I also played with mirror-accelerated parity in Win10 1903 in NTFS using powershell commands, but I was not happy with the results. Like you have observed, with Win10 SS updating itself, I believe the difference in implementation between Win10 SS and WS2019 SSD makes the commands and deployment seems to be transferable between platforms but we know that to not be the case. For example, you can not open or view an updated Win10 1903 SS on any WS2019 instances. But going the other way, Win10 can certainly read any WS2019 SSD, even in ReFS [as I’ve last tested about 1 month ago].

The write back cache situation is harder to describe. I do not see it as having long term effects on sustained large writes, which is what I want it for. While mirror-accelerated parity does improve performance, the area that M$ and others have focused their efforts on is in read performance, and not sustained large writes. So even if you set WBC to 100, 200 or xxx GB, it doesn’t help once that is filled and the faster drives are then dumping data onto spinners, direct writing to TLC and offloading DRAM cache. This is where enterprise SSD’s may actually help write performance.

I am not usually one to spew off these conjectures and assumptions, but Win10 SS has so little to no documentation, that all tests are done on a trial and error basis. And even WS2019 SSD, eventho there are tons of documentation online, the real pudding is not in some hobbyist hack of SSD into submission. Hardware and deployment constraints, such as the need for enterprise SSD, along with recommended best practice of using 3 or 4 nodes minimum for mirror-accelerated parity, it makes playing with WS2019 SSD in a homelab, an exercise in frustration.

I made this account just today since I found you’ve linked my thread. As such I can’t paste links yet, but there’s a thread I started recently on reddit. I may never buy enterprise level SSD’s and I might try FreeNAS or unRAID before getting more expensive equipment.

reddit dot com /r/DataHoarder/comments/c8tucj/my_experience_with_storage_spaces_after_3_years/

Источник

Сравнение файловых систем ReFS (Resilient file system) и NTFS

В этой статье разберёмся какие возможности предоставляет ReFS и чем она лучше файловой системы NTFS . Как восстановить данные с дискового пространства ReFS. Новая файловая система ReFS от компании Microsoft была первоначально представлена в ОС Windows Server 2012. Она также включена в Windows 10, в составе инструмента Дисковое пространство . ReFS можно использовать для пула дисков. С выходом Windows Server 2016 файловая система была улучшена, вскоре она будет доступна в новой версии Windows 10.

Какие возможности предоставляет ReFS и чем она лучше текущей NTFS системы?

Что означает ReFS?

Сокращение от «Resilient File System» , ReFS – эта новая система, созданная на базе NTFS. На данном этапе ReFS не предлагает комплексную замену NTFS для использования на диске домашних пользователей. Файловая система имеет свои преимущества и недостатки.

ReFS предназначена для решения основных проблем NTFS . Она более устойчива к повреждению данных, лучше справляется с повышенной нагрузкой и легко масштабируется для очень больших файловых систем. Давайте рассмотрим, что это означает?

ReFS защищает данные от повреждения

Файловая система использует контрольные суммы для метаданных, а также может использовать контрольные суммы для данных файла. Во время чтения или записи файла, система проверяет контрольную сумму что бы убедиться в её правильности. Таким образом осуществляется обнаружение искаженных данных в режиме реального времени.

ReFS интегрирована с функцией Дисковое пространство. Если вы настроили зеркальное хранилище данных, то с помощью ReFS Windows обнаружит и автоматически устранит повреждение файловой системы, скопировав данные с другого диска. Эта функция доступна как в Windows 10, так и Windows 8.1.

Если файловая система обнаружит поврежденные данные, которые не имеют альтернативной копии для восстановления, то ReFS сразу удалить такие данные с диска. Это не потребует перезагрузки системы или отключения устройства хранения информации, как в случае с NTFS.

Необходимость использования утилиты chkdsk полностью исчезает, так как файловая система автоматически корректируется сразу в момент возникновения ошибки. Новая система устойчива и к другим вариантам повреждения данных. NTFS во время записи метаданных файла записывает их напрямую. Если в это время произойдет отключение питания или сбой компьютера, вы получите повреждение данных.

Во время изменения метаданных ReFS создает новую копию данных и связывает данные с файлом, только после записи метаданных на диск. Это исключает возможность повреждения данных. Эта функция называется копированием на запись, она присутствует и в других популярных ОС Linux системах: ZFS, BtrFS, а также файловой системе Apple APFS.

В ReFS удалены некоторые ограничения NTFS

ReFS более современна и поддерживает гораздо большие объемы и более длинные имена файлов чем NTFS. В долгосрочной перспективе это важные улучшения. В файловой системе NTFS имя файла ограничено 255 символами, в ReFS имя файла может содержать до 32768 символов. Windows 10 позволяет отключить ограничение на предел символов для файловых систем NTFS, но он всегда отключается на томах ReFS.

В ReFS больше не поддерживаются короткие имена файлов в формате DOS 8.3. На томе NTFS вы можете получить доступ к C:\Program Files\ в C:\PROGRA

1\ для обеспечения совместимости со старым программным обеспечением.

NTFS имеет теоретический максимальный объем в размере 16 эксабайт, а у ReFS теоретический максимальный объем – 262144 экзабайт. Хотя сейчас это не имеет большого значения, но компьютера постоянно развиваются.

Какая файловая система быстрее ReFS или NTFS?

ReFS разрабатывалась не для повышения производительности файловой системы по сравнению с NTFS. Microsoft сделала систему ReFS намного эффективнее в строго определённых случаях.

Например, при использовании с Дисковым пространством, ReFS поддерживает «оптимизацию в режиме реального времени». Допустим у вас есть пул накопителей с двумя дисками, один обеспечивает максимальную производительность, другой используется для объема. ReFS всегда будет записывать данные на более быстрый диск, обеспечивая максимальную производительность. В фоновом режиме файловая система автоматически переместит большие куски данных на более медленные диски для продолжительного хранения.

В Windows Server 2016 Microsoft улучшила ReFS, для обеспечения лучшей производительности функций виртуальной машины. Виртуальная машина Microsoft Hyper-V использует эти преимущества (теоретически, любая виртуальная машина может использовать преимущества ReFS).

Например, ReFS поддерживает клонирование блоков, это ускоряет процесс клонирования виртуальных машин и операций слияния контрольных точек. Чтобы создать копию виртуальной машины, ReFS нужно только записать новые метаданные на диск и указать ссылку на уже существующие данные. Это связано с тем, что в ReFS несколько файлов могут указывать на одни и те же базовые данные на диске.

Когда виртуальная машина записывает новые данные на диск, они записываются в другое место, а исходные данные виртуальной машины остаются на диске. Это значительно ускоряет процесс клонирования и требует гораздо меньшей пропускной способности диска.

ReFS также предлагает новую функцию «редкого VDL» , которая позволяет ReFS быстро записывать нули в большой файл. Это значительно ускоряет создание нового, пустого файла виртуального жесткого диска фиксированного размера (VHD). В NTFS эта операция может занять 10 минут, в ReFS – несколько секунд.

Почему ReFS не может заменить NTFS

Не смотря на ряд преимуществ ReFS не может пока заменить NTFS. Windows не может загрузиться с раздела ReFS и требует NTFS. В ReFS не поддерживаются такие функции NTFS как сжатие данных, шифрование файловой системы, жесткие ссылки, расширенные атрибуты, дедупликация данных и дисковые квоты. Но в отличии от NTFS, ReFS позволяет выполнить полное шифрование диска c помощью BitLocker, включая системные структуры диска.

Windows 10 не позволяет отформатировать раздел в ReFS, эта файловая система доступна только в рамках Дискового пространства. ReFS защищает данные используемые на пулах из нескольких жестких дисков от повреждения. В Windows Server 2016 вы можете форматировать тома с помощью ReFS вместо NTFS. Такой том можно использовать для хранения виртуальных машин, но операционная система по-прежнему может загружаться только с NTFS.

Как восстановить данные с дискового пространства ReFS

Hetman Partition Recovery позволяет проанализировать дисковое пространство под управлением файловой системой ReFS с помощью алгоритма сигнатурного анализа. Анализируя устройство сектор за сектором программа находит определенные последовательности байт и отображает их пользователю. Восстановление данных с дискового пространства ReFS не отличается от работы с файловой системой NTFS:

  • Загрузите и установите программу;
  • Проанализируйте физический диск, который входит в дисковое пространство;
  • Выберите и сохраните файлы которые необходимо восстановить;
  • Повторите пункты 2 и 3 для всех дисков входящих в дисковое пространство.

Будущее новой файловой системы довольно туманно. Microsoft может доработать ReFS для замены устаревшей NTFS во всех версиях Windows. На данный момент ReFS не может использоваться повсеместно и служит только для определенных задач.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

  • Windows 10 stopcode синий экран
  • Windows 10 stopcode при установке
  • Windows 10 sticky notes установить
  • Windows 10 sticky notes не запускается
  • Windows 10 startup numlock on